This fixes an issue in `morph list-artifacts` and probably other commands:
ERROR: Command failed: morph list-artifacts --quiet file:///ws/master/git.baserock.org/baserock/baserock/definitions HEAD systems/build-system-armv7lhf-jetson.morph systems/weston-system-armv7lhf-jetson.morph systems/genivi-baseline-system-armv7lhf-jetson.morph
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/cliapp/app.py", line 190, in _run
self.process_args(args)
File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/morphlib/app.py", line 290, in process_args
cliapp.Application.process_args(self, args)
File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/cliapp/app.py", line 539, in process_args
method(args[1:])
File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/morphlib/plugins/list_artifacts_plugin.py", line 67, in list_artifacts
repo, ref, system_filename)
File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/morphlib/plugins/list_artifacts_plugin.py", line 91, in list_artifacts_for_system
status_cb=self.app.status)
File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/morphlib/sourceresolver.py", line 641, in create_source_pool
definitions_original_ref=original_ref)
File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/morphlib/sourceresolver.py", line 583, in traverse_morphs
definitions_absref, definitions_tree, visit)
File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/morphlib/sourceresolver.py", line 408, in _process_definitions_with_children
definitions_queue = collections.deque(system_filenames)
TypeError: 'NoneType' object is not iterable
The issue is that the sourceresolver.create_source_pool() function did
not work correctly if passed a single filename. This was a regression from
commit 4cc75039a78bd8aef9ef464bc0eb6c3ff16809d0.
In order to have a logical function prototype, the create_source_pool()
function now only takes a list of systems, instead of taking either a
single system or a list.

It gets messy having hundreds of build-step-xx.log files in the current
directory, and if two builds are run in parallel from the same directory
the logs for a given chunk will be mixed together in one file.
Now, a new directory named build-0, build-1, build-2 etc is created for
each new build.
If the user passes --initiator-step-output-dir the logs will be placed
in that directory, instead. This behaviour is the same as before.

The recent changes to the BuildCommand.build() function caused distbuild
to break, because I didn't make the same change to the
InitiatorBuildCommand.build() function but did change how it was called.
This commit adds the ability to have optional fields in distbuild
messages. This is used to add an optional 'original_ref' field, which
will get passed to `morph serialise-artifact` by new distbuild
controllers, and will be ignored by older ones.

You can bind to an ephemeral port by passing 0 as the port number.
To work out which port you actually got, you need to call getsockname().
To facilitate being able to spawn multiple copies of the daemons for
testing environments, you can pass a -file option, which will make the
daemon write which port it actually bound to.
If this path is a fifo, reading from it in the spawner process will
allow synchronisation of only spawning services that require that port to
be ready after it is.
